1099端口号被占用,IDEA不能正常运行Web工程

时间:2024-03-12 17:37:44

问题
在使用IDEA软件运行Web工程连接TomCat时出现1099号端口已经被占用。
解决
1.找到在使用1099号端口的进程的PID:
windows+r键
输入cmd打开命令窗口
输入:netstat -aon | findstr 1099
(回车后显示出来的代码最后一列就是该进程的PID)

 

前两次的1099没有反应是因为我的计算机的1099号端口没有被占用,所以这时我们拿1098端口举例,最后一列的5156便是占用了1098端口的PID

 

2.根据PID去关闭该进程:
输入:taskkill -f -pid 5156 (假设这里PID为5156的进程占用了1099号端口
如过上面不能关闭此进程(出现拒绝访问)
我们可以采用第二种方法:
打开任务管理器,在进程页面找到PID为此PID(假设这里是5156)的进程,手动结束进程(选中进程右键点击结束任务)即可。
(如果任务管理器没有显示PID,鼠标移动到窗口“名称”处右键选中PID)

                                   

拓展
输入:tasklist | findstr "5156 "
(查看PID为5156 的进程信息)